Output 020e89882ce374821c7a58bf0a20851572f4bfa95808c67f6efa23cf86f6e4d3:0

value
151504000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 761d5498a65677c63d1920b9c646e7ec6683df59 OP_EQUAL
address
MJfh6yuFUmKdmCmtQ5zWFFHKpehfoHu5tE
transaction
020e89882ce374821c7a58bf0a20851572f4bfa95808c67f6efa23cf86f6e4d3
spent
true